Decentralized storage has been gaining popularity in recent years as a more secure and efficient alternative to traditional centralized storage systems. With the rise of blockchain technology, decentralized storage has become a viable option for individuals and businesses looking to store their data in a more secure and private manner. The concept of decentralized storage is based on the idea of distributing data across a network of nodes, rather than storing it in a single centralized location. This not only makes the data more secure, as it is not vulnerable to a single point of failure, but also allows for greater accessibility and flexibility. As the demand for secure and private data storage continues to grow, decentralized storage is expected to play a significant role in the future of data management.
The rise of decentralized storage can also be attributed to the increasing concerns over data privacy and security. With centralized storage systems, there is always a risk of data breaches and unauthorized access, as the data is stored in a single location. Decentralized storage, on the other hand, distributes the data across multiple nodes, making it much more difficult for hackers to gain access to the entire dataset. This added layer of security has made decentralized storage an attractive option for businesses and individuals looking to protect their sensitive information. Additionally, decentralized storage also offers greater transparency and control over data, as users can track where their data is being stored and who has access to it. As a result, the rise of decentralized storage is expected to continue as more people seek out secure and private data storage solutions.
How Decentralized Storage Works
Decentralized storage works by distributing data across a network of nodes, rather than storing it in a single centralized location. This is made possible through the use of blockchain technology, which allows for the creation of a distributed ledger that records all transactions and data storage activities. When a user uploads data to a decentralized storage network, the data is broken up into smaller pieces and distributed across multiple nodes in the network. Each node stores a small piece of the data, and the entire dataset is encrypted to ensure security and privacy. When the user wants to access their data, the network retrieves the pieces from each node and reassembles them to provide the user with their complete dataset. This process not only makes the data more secure, as it is not vulnerable to a single point of failure, but also allows for greater accessibility and flexibility.
One of the key components of decentralized storage is the use of smart contracts, which are self-executing contracts with the terms of the agreement directly written into code. Smart contracts are used to automate the process of storing and retrieving data on the decentralized network, ensuring that all transactions are secure and transparent. Additionally, decentralized storage networks often use a consensus mechanism, such as proof of work or proof of stake, to validate and secure transactions on the network. This helps to prevent unauthorized access and ensures that the data remains secure and private. Overall, decentralized storage works by leveraging blockchain technology to distribute data across a network of nodes, providing users with a more secure and efficient way to store their data.
Benefits of Decentralized Storage
There are several benefits to using decentralized storage, including increased security, privacy, accessibility, and flexibility. One of the main benefits of decentralized storage is its enhanced security features. By distributing data across a network of nodes, rather than storing it in a single centralized location, decentralized storage makes it much more difficult for hackers to gain access to the entire dataset. This added layer of security helps to protect sensitive information from unauthorized access and data breaches. Additionally, decentralized storage also offers greater privacy for users, as they have more control over who has access to their data. With traditional centralized storage systems, users often have to trust a third party with their data, which can lead to concerns over privacy and security. Decentralized storage, on the other hand, allows users to track where their data is being stored and who has access to it, providing them with greater transparency and control over their information.
Another benefit of decentralized storage is its increased accessibility and flexibility. With traditional centralized storage systems, users are often limited by the capacity and availability of the central server. Decentralized storage, however, allows for greater accessibility and flexibility, as the data is distributed across multiple nodes in the network. This means that users can access their data from anywhere in the world, at any time, without having to rely on a single centralized location. Additionally, decentralized storage also offers greater flexibility in terms of scalability and cost-effectiveness. As the demand for storage space grows, decentralized storage networks can easily scale to accommodate more users and data, without incurring significant costs. Overall, the benefits of decentralized storage make it an attractive option for individuals and businesses looking for secure and private data storage solutions.
Challenges and Risks of Decentralized Storage
While decentralized storage offers many benefits, there are also several challenges and risks associated with its adoption. One of the main challenges of decentralized storage is its complexity and technical requirements. Unlike traditional centralized storage systems, which are often managed by a third party, decentralized storage requires users to have a certain level of technical expertise in order to set up and manage their own nodes on the network. This can be a barrier for individuals and businesses who are not familiar with blockchain technology or do not have the resources to invest in setting up their own nodes. Additionally, decentralized storage also faces challenges in terms of interoperability with existing systems and applications. As decentralized storage networks continue to evolve, there will be a need for greater integration with traditional storage systems and applications in order to ensure seamless data management.
Another challenge of decentralized storage is its susceptibility to network attacks and vulnerabilities. While decentralized storage offers increased security compared to traditional centralized systems, it is not immune to potential threats such as 51% attacks or double spending attacks. These types of attacks can compromise the integrity of the network and lead to unauthorized access or manipulation of data. Additionally, decentralized storage also faces risks related to regulatory compliance and legal issues. As decentralized storage networks continue to grow in popularity, there will be a need for greater clarity and regulation around data privacy and security standards. This will require collaboration between industry stakeholders and regulatory bodies in order to establish best practices for decentralized storage adoption.
The Next Generation of Decentralized Storage
The next generation of decentralized storage is expected to bring about significant advancements in terms of scalability, interoperability, and user experience. One of the key areas of focus for the next generation of decentralized storage is scalability. As the demand for secure and private data storage continues to grow, decentralized storage networks will need to scale in order to accommodate more users and data. This will require advancements in blockchain technology and consensus mechanisms in order to support larger datasets and higher transaction volumes. Additionally, the next generation of decentralized storage will also focus on interoperability with existing systems and applications. As more businesses look to adopt decentralized storage solutions, there will be a need for greater integration with traditional storage systems in order to ensure seamless data management.
Another area of focus for the next generation of decentralized storage is user experience. In order to drive widespread adoption, decentralized storage networks will need to provide users with a seamless and intuitive experience when it comes to storing and accessing their data. This will require advancements in user interfaces and accessibility features in order to make decentralized storage more user-friendly for individuals and businesses. Additionally, the next generation of decentralized storage will also focus on enhancing security features in order to protect against potential threats and vulnerabilities. This will require advancements in encryption techniques and consensus mechanisms in order to ensure that data remains secure and private on the network.
Considerations for Adopting Decentralized Storage
When considering adopting decentralized storage, there are several key factors that individuals and businesses should take into account in order to ensure a successful implementation. One of the main considerations for adopting decentralized storage is understanding the technical requirements and resources needed to set up and manage nodes on the network. This may require individuals and businesses to invest in training or seek out third-party providers who can assist with setting up and managing their nodes. Additionally, individuals and businesses should also consider the interoperability of decentralized storage with existing systems and applications in order to ensure seamless data management.
Another consideration for adopting decentralized storage is understanding the regulatory compliance and legal implications associated with storing data on a decentralized network. As decentralized storage continues to grow in popularity, there will be a need for greater clarity around data privacy and security standards in order to ensure compliance with regulatory requirements. This may require collaboration between industry stakeholders and regulatory bodies in order to establish best practices for decentralized storage adoption. Additionally, individuals and businesses should also consider the potential risks associated with network attacks and vulnerabilities when adopting decentralized storage. This may require investing in additional security measures or seeking out providers who offer enhanced security features on their networks.
Future Trends in Decentralized Storage
Looking ahead, there are several future trends that are expected to shape the evolution of decentralized storage in the coming years. One of the main future trends in decentralized storage is the continued advancement of blockchain technology and consensus mechanisms in order to support larger datasets and higher transaction volumes. As the demand for secure and private data storage continues to grow, decentralized storage networks will need to scale in order to accommodate more users and data. This will require advancements in blockchain technology in order to support larger datasets and higher transaction volumes.
Another future trend in decentralized storage is the continued focus on interoperability with existing systems and applications. As more businesses look to adopt decentralized storage solutions, there will be a need for greater integration with traditional storage systems in order to ensure seamless data management. This will require advancements in interoperability standards and protocols in order to facilitate seamless data transfer between different systems and applications.
Additionally, future trends in decentralized storage will also focus on enhancing user experience in order to drive widespread adoption. This will require advancements in user interfaces and accessibility features in order to make decentralized storage more user-friendly for individuals and businesses. Additionally, future trends in decentralized storage will also focus on enhancing security features in order to protect against potential threats and vulnerabilities.
In conclusion, decentralized storage offers many benefits including increased security, privacy, accessibility, flexibility but also faces challenges such as complexity, technical requirements, network attacks vulnerabilities among others. The next generation of decentralized storage is expected to bring about significant advancements in terms of scalability interoperability user experience among others while considering adopting it one should take into account technical requirements resources needed regulatory compliance legal implications among others Future trends include advancement of blockchain technology consensus mechanisms interoperability with existing systems applications among others . Additionally, the integration of artificial intelligence and machine learning into decentralized storage systems is expected to improve efficiency and data management. As the technology continues to evolve, it is important for individuals and organizations to stay informed about the latest developments and best practices in order to make informed decisions about adopting decentralized storage solutions.